How do you calculate solar power?

1. Basic Formula to Calculate Solar Power The general formula is: Power Output (Watts) = Panel Wattage × Sun Hours × Number of Panels × System Efficiency To calculate the energy produced per day (in kilowatt-hours): Daily Output (kWh) = (Total Watts × Sun Hours × Efficiency) ÷ 1000

How do I calculate solar panel output?

The easiest way to work out solar panel output is by using our solar panel calculator. Power in watts (W) x Average hours of direct sunlight x 0.75 = Daily Watt-hours. Note: Our Solar Panel Tool will deliver a far better output so we’d highly recommend using it.

How does solar output calculator work?

You just input the wattage, peak solar hours, and you get what is the estimated output of your solar panel like this: Example of how Solar Output Calculator works: 300W solar panel with 5 peak sun hours will generate 1.13 kWh per day.
